"123 15" is a dedicated telephone and internet platform for reporting consumer complaints in China. On March 1999, the State Administration for Industry and Commerce set up a special telephone for handling consumer complaints and reports, and then launched the Internet platform of 123 15. After dialing 123 15, if you need to complain or report, please answer the questions according to the staff's prompts, truthfully tell the facts, reasons and requirements of the complaint, and tell your name, address, telephone number or other contact information as well as the name, address and telephone number of the respondent.

In order to expand the China market, PPF Group set up a representative office in Beijing in 2004, and officially launched consumer credit business in Guangfo, China in February 2007, and launched consumer financial services in Shenzhen, Chengdu and Tianjin in 2008, with more than 1000 employees.

On February 2, 2010/day, PPF group formally approved the establishment of a consumer finance company in Tianjin. After obtaining the approval from the regulatory authorities, PPF Group will start to build the first wholly foreign-owned consumer finance company in China according to the Regulations on the Administration of Consumer Finance Companies promulgated by China in August 2009. The new Tianjin Consumer Finance Company will be named "Gitzo Consumer Finance (China) Co., Ltd.", which is funded by PPF Group with a registered capital of 300 million yuan.
